Principal Ad Research and Insights
-
The Opportunity
The AdResearch& Insightspositionis a senior, strategic role responsible for designing and executing primary research initiatives thatdemonstratethe effectiveness of advertising acrossHPMedia Network. This individual will translate data and research findings into compelling insights, narratives, and case studies that enable advertisers to understand the value of HP’sMediaNetwork’sofferings and empower the Ad Sales organization to close new business.
As thesubject‑matterexpert on advertiser research and measurement storytelling, this role will surfacedata‑drivenproof points thatshowcasecampaign impact, uncover insights into audience behavior, and elevate HP Media Network’s position in the marketplace through credible, actionable insights.
This position offers an exciting opportunity to contribute to a rapidly growing business within a fast-paced performance-oriented environment, where you will serve as a trusted authority in AdResearchand a key enabler ofadvertiser confidence, sales effectiveness, and the continued growth of HP Media Network’s revenue streams.
Key Responsibilities
Design and execute a wide range of primary research studies(e.g., brand lift, purchase intent, messaging effectiveness, audience insights), either in-houseor through 3P vendors,to assess advertiser campaign impact across the HP Media Network.
Own the end-to-end research process, includingmethodologydesign,kickoff calls,vendor coordination (as applicable), data analysis, interpretation, and synthesis of findingsto present results both internally and externally
Translate research outcomes into clear, persuasive case studies, narratives, and sales-ready materials thatdemonstratecampaign effectiveness and advertiser ROI.
Partner closely with Ad Sales, Client Solutions,Ad OperationsandProductMarketing teams to understand advertiserobjectivesand align research outputs to active and prospective sales priorities.
Develop standardized frameworks and best practices for measuring and communicating ad effectiveness across HP Media Network formats and environments.
Identifytrends and patterns across research studies to generate network-level insights that highlight the overall performance and differentiation of HP Media Network advertising.
Present research findings and insights to internal stakeholders, including sales leadership and cross-functional partners, ensuring clarity, credibility, and actionability.
Continuously evaluate and improve research methodologies, measurement approaches, and insight storytelling to keep pace with industry standards and advertiser expectations.
